HomeMy Public PortalAboutPresentation - Overhead to Underground Conversions.pdfFPL Overhead to Underground Conversions: Sequence of Events & CIAC Specifics CIAC - (Removal Cost + NBV - Salvage) of Existing Fac►lities + (UG Cost - OH Cost) of New Facilities • CIAC = Contribution in Aid of Construction • Removal Cost =Cost to Remove Existing Overhead Facilities • NBV = Net Book Value of Overhead Facilities = Original Installed Cost of the Existing Overhead Facilities Less Accumulated Depreciation. • Salvage = Salvage Value of Existing Overhead Facilities. • (UG Cost - OH Cost) New Facilities = Differential Cost Between New Underground & Equivalent Overhead Facilities. i WV 'V A M' rr 7 rp ry rp- r • w v rr v e,' v, v v v v v v v Responsibilities • FPL provides non -binding "ballpark" estimate, no charge (to help you decide whether to proceed or not) • FPL provides binding estimate for non-refundable deposit - Deposit amount = $1.20/ft - Applied toward CIAC if contract signed within 180 days - Estimate is valid for 180 days - Estimate requires 10 to 15 weeks to produce (pending agreement on easement locations) • Applicant makes arrangements with other utilities • Applicant arranges conversion of service entrances FPL 7 • t . 7 .E* 4 v v - •,r .r •s "_ ': •w 'w v.! ' cV 'w 'Mr '�.w 4Wr '� S! a11, MP A' VIP' \W Rw7 1 r • If undergrounding is feasible, FPL provides: - non -binding "ballpark" estimate, at no charge - nonrefundable engineering deposit amount • FPL performs detailed engineering and determines CIAC amount (estimate valid for 180 days) Sequence of Events (cont') • Within 180 days of receiving FPL's estimate, Applicant: - Enters into Facilities Conversion Agreement - Pays CIAC amount (Engineering deposit applied towards CIAC) or, estimate expires (in which case FPL retains deposit) • Applicant executes agreements with other utilities (e.g. Telephone, CATV, etc.) for simultaneous conversion of their facilities FPL 6 VW Vw Vw vW VW VW VW VW VW V7 VW VW VW Sequence of Events (cont') • Applicant secures and records all easements (with opinion of title that easements are valid) and permission from property owners to place above grade equipment within their property (due within 180 days of receipt of binding estimate) • Utilities secure permits • FPL installs main underground facilities, coordinating with other utilities as appropriate FPL 7 +f • 'VFW +1 Sequence of Events (cont') • Appointments are scheduled with home/business owners to convert overhead service drops to underground Residential (typical): - Applicant/Customer/Electrician secures required electrical permit, arranges appointment with FPL - Applicant/Customer/Electrician excavates trench, installs FPL conduit from main line to meter can - FPL disconnects and removes service drop & meter Electrician converts meter can (I.e. weatherhead to downpipe) - Electrical Inspector inspects installation - FPL installs/connects buried conductors, and reinstalls meter Applicant/Customer completes restoration FPL 8 Sequence of Events (cont) • Appointments are scheduled with home/business owners to convert overhead service drops to underground Non -Residential (typical): - Applicant/Customer/Electrician secures electrical permit, arranges appointment with FPL - Applicant/Customer/Electrician excavates trench and installs Customer owned conduit from main FPL line to meter can - FPL disconnects and removes service drop & meter - Electrician converts meter can (Le. weatherhead to downpipe) and installs Customer owned cable to FPL designated point - Electrical Inspector inspects installation FPL connects Customer owned conductors, and reinstalls meter - Applicant/Customer completes restoration FPL 9 " After all electric service drops are removed, remaining ' ' ' electrical facilities are removed " Applicant completes all restoration (roadways, sidewalks, driveways, and landscaping - If less than estimate, applicant receives refund - If more than estimate, applicant pays difference (up to 10% of original CIAC amount) FPL
